This podcast interview discusses why Kris wrote the book Bitten, and makes a call for new researchers to enter the field of tick-borne illnesses.  We discuss how  PTLDS blocks access to care for patients and the need to treat underlying infections.  She describes how she and her husband got sick with Lyme and coinfections after a vacation to Martha's Vineyard, and how they could not get diagnosed and treatment.  After a year passed after their infection and $60,000 spent, they got a diagnosis and treatment. They are now doing well but could've avoided so much by getting the help they needed early on.  Her book info found here https://www.krisnewby.com/.
